The 2018 session is starting and MGRC is again sponsoring a free series of training and networking opportunities for new lobbyists (old lobbyist too!) on important issues at the Capitol and the legislative process.

Without question, federal tax conformity is going to be the most significant issue of 2018, and one of the leading tax experts at the legislature, House Research’s Legislative Analyst Joel Michael, will be our first Lobbyist 101 speaker.

Mr. Michael will walk through the complex process of updating Minnesota’s tax code and answer our questions about the ramifications of these changes.
